通过与 Jira 对比,让您更全面了解 PingCode

  • 首页
  • 需求与产品管理
  • 项目管理
  • 测试与缺陷管理
  • 知识管理
  • 效能度量
        • 更多产品

          客户为中心的产品管理工具

          专业的软件研发项目管理工具

          简单易用的团队知识库管理

          可量化的研发效能度量工具

          测试用例维护与计划执行

          以团队为中心的协作沟通

          研发工作流自动化工具

          账号认证与安全管理工具

          Why PingCode
          为什么选择 PingCode ?

          6000+企业信赖之选,为研发团队降本增效

        • 行业解决方案
          先进制造(即将上线)
        • 解决方案1
        • 解决方案2
  • Jira替代方案

25人以下免费

目录

怎么自己开发一款手游

怎么自己开发一款手游

开发一款手游不仅需要精湛的技术和创新的想法,还需要对市场有深入的理解和对用户需求的敏锐把握。首先,你需要确定游戏的类型和风格,提供一个吸引人的故事背景和角色设定。然后,你需要选择合适的开发工具和平台,如Unity或Unreal Engine,绘制游戏图像,编写游戏代码,并进行测试和调整。在游戏开发完成后,你还需要进行市场推广和运营,以吸引玩家并保持其持续的兴趣。

一、确定游戏类型和风格

在开发手游之前,你需要首先确定你要开发的是什么类型的游戏。这将直接影响到你的开发工作,包括游戏的设计、编程和美术工作。游戏类型包括动作游戏、冒险游戏、角色扮演游戏、策略游戏等等,你需要根据你的目标用户群体和你自己的兴趣来选择。

同时,你还需要确定游戏的风格。游戏风格包括现实主义风格、卡通风格、抽象风格等等,你可以根据你的游戏类型和故事背景来选择。

二、选择开发工具和平台

在确定了游戏类型和风格后,你需要选择合适的开发工具和平台。目前,Unity和Unreal Engine是最常用的游戏开发引擎,它们都提供了丰富的开发工具和资源,可以帮助你高效地完成游戏开发工作。

Unity是一款跨平台的游戏开发引擎,它支持2D和3D游戏开发,适合各种类型的游戏。Unity提供了丰富的教程和文档,对初学者非常友好。

Unreal Engine则是一款强大的3D游戏开发引擎,它提供了高级的图像渲染和物理模拟功能,适合开发高质量的3D游戏。

三、绘制游戏图像和编写游戏代码

在选择了开发工具和平台后,你需要开始绘制游戏图像和编写游戏代码。这是游戏开发的核心工作,也是最需要技术和创新的部分。

游戏图像包括游戏的场景、角色、道具等元素,你可以使用Photoshop或者Illustrator等图像处理软件来创建。同时,你也需要设计游戏的用户界面,包括菜单、按钮和提示等元素。

游戏代码则是控制游戏运行的逻辑,你需要使用C#或者JavaScript等编程语言来编写。你需要实现游戏的各种功能,如角色的移动、攻击、跳跃等,以及游戏的得分、胜利和失败等条件。

四、测试和调整游戏

在完成了游戏图像和代码的编写后,你需要进行游戏的测试和调整。测试是为了找出游戏中的错误和问题,调整则是为了改进游戏的体验和平衡。

你可以自己测试游戏,也可以邀请其他人参与测试。你需要记录下所有的问题,并进行修复和优化。同时,你也需要根据测试的反馈来调整游戏的难度、节奏和奖励等元素,以提升游戏的吸引力和可玩性。

五、市场推广和运营

在游戏开发完成后,你还需要进行市场推广和运营。你需要制定一个有效的营销策略,包括游戏的定价、发布渠道、广告推广等。

你可以通过社交媒体、游戏论坛和博客等方式来推广你的游戏,提高游戏的知名度和吸引力。同时,你也需要通过更新内容、举办活动和提供服务等方式来维护你的用户群体,保持其对游戏的持续兴趣。

开发一款手游是一个复杂而挑战的过程,但是只要你有热情和决心,就一定能够成功。所以,如果你有一个好的游戏想法,就勇敢地去实现它吧!

相关问答FAQs:

1. 有没有必要自己开发一款手游?

自己开发一款手游可以提供更多的创造空间和自由度,而且可以根据自己的想法和创意设计游戏玩法,满足个人的需求和兴趣。同时,自己开发手游也可以获得更多的收益和知名度。

2. 我需要具备哪些技能才能自己开发一款手游?

自己开发一款手游需要掌握一些基本的编程技能,比如C++、Java、Python等编程语言。此外,还需要了解游戏设计原理、图形设计、音效制作等相关知识。如果没有相关技能,可以考虑参加相关的培训课程或者招聘专业人士来帮助开发。

3. 自己开发一款手游需要多长时间?

开发一款手游的时间因人而异,取决于游戏的复杂程度和开发者的技术水平。一般来说,从构思到最终发布,可能需要几个月甚至几年的时间。在开发过程中,需要不断调试和优化,以确保游戏的质量和用户体验。因此,需要有耐心和坚持的精神。

相关文章